TSGT Crawford Aldo Riemenschneider, age 90, of Lawrenceville.

His parents, The Late Mr. and Mrs. Lewis Henry and Lorina Olidine McCurdy Riemenschneider; also by his wife Ruth E. Riemenschneider.

He was a member of the New Hope Rd. Church of Christ. He served during WWII in the Army, serving in Europe and North Africa. He was a retired printer with the Atlanta Journal Constitution. He was a former member of the Lakeland and the Yargo Community Concert Bands.

He is survived by two sons and daughter-in-laws, Von and Ruth Riemenschneider, Thomaston and Jay and Terri Riemenschneider, Auburn.
One sister, Bessie Jane Owens, Battle Creek, MI.
Eight Grandchildren and twelve Great Grandchildren survive.
